trachyte (sh)




Light-coloured, very fine-grained igneous rock composed chiefly of alkali feldspar with only minor mafic minerals (biotite, hornblende, or pyroxene).

Trachyte is commonly found in volcanic regions; like many volcanic rocks, it shows a streaked or banded structure due to flowing of the congealing lava.


forced cycle (medicine)


forced cycle
<cardiology, physiology> A cardiac cycle (atrial or ventricular) that is cut short by a forced beat.
